I first tested the EOS Mini Thresher Fixed Blade EOS099 on a weekend camping trip in the Appalachian Mountains. The conditions were typical for the region – humid with occasional light rain. I primarily used it for tasks like preparing kindling, food preparation, and light batoning.
The knife performed admirably in wet conditions, thanks to the textured aluminum handle, providing a secure grip even with damp hands. The black coated CPM-3V carbon steel blade held its edge well, slicing cleanly through wood and rope. I was surprised by the amount of control the size allowed.
There was a minor adjustment period getting used to the smaller handle size. However, the ergonomics are well-designed enough that it quickly felt like a natural extension of my hand. No significant issues arose during this first outing.

Breaking Down the Features of EOS Mini Thresher Fixed Blade EOS099
Specifications
- The EOS Mini Thresher Fixed Blade EOS099 has an overall length of 7.5 inches (19.05 cm). This compact size makes it easy to carry and maneuver in tight spaces.
- The blade length is 3.5 inches (8.89 cm), constructed from CPM-3V carbon steel known for its exceptional toughness and edge retention. The black coating adds a layer of corrosion resistance and reduces glare.
- The handle is made of black aluminum, providing a lightweight yet durable grip. The full, extended tang ensures strength and stability during demanding tasks.
- Additional features include a lanyard hole for secure carry options. A black finish spike backspacer can be used for striking or breaking glass in emergency situations.
- The black Kydex belt sheath provides secure and comfortable carry on a belt or pack. It also has good retention. The knife weighs 0.56 lb.
